Transaction e825ddf1406903d332e9cb1ddda1f2dbd47508602291f495cbb39b263df5da7d

1 Input
1 Outputs
  • e825ddf1406903d332e9cb1ddda1f2dbd47508602291f495cbb39b263df5da7d:0
  • value  173192
    address  3314sppQCqA2K7KcV3juW23gFyWC4TCuie